Levator, LIVE! (Phase I Episode 097)
As I am prone to do from time to time, this week I had a special in-studio performance by Levator. Strickly speaking, Levator IS Sky Lynn (on guitar, vocals & effects), who, in the past, has been joined by various other friends and collaborators. This time she was joined by Rando Skrasek on drums, who provided an excellent back-beat for her carefully constructed and beautifully layered songs. Comparisons to Galaxie 500 or Mazzy Star are possible, but Sky manages to reach sonic textures that skirt the edge of Sonic Youth proportions, and has other, more sparse moments that conjur a singer-songwriter motif. But to really get a feel for what I’m talking about, you just gotta tune in.

The Undoing Of David Wright, LIVE! (KPSU Phase I Episode 060)
Please join me for a special “Church of Blasphuphmus” broadcast as we host The Undoing of David Wright for the first half hour, who play a unique blend of synth and math rock whose latest release, We Dig With Fingers Crossed, is a rock opera in the best possible way, discussing grave robbing and murder that occurred in the late 1800s. For the second half hour, the band will pick out songs by some of their favorite bands and comrades. It should prove to be a great show for those who were waiting for me to play something non-garage-y. 5 P.M. – 6 P.M.

The Frasier Fantasy w/ Katie (KPSU Phase I Episode 047)
This show is from near the end of my first full year at KPSU, and by this point, I was deep into my Nuggets / 60’s rock phase as a DJ. My friend DJ Revolting Earwig had turned me on to the Nuggets boxed set (both Vol. 1 & 2), right around the time picked up Syd Barrett era Pink Floyd, Love & The Great Society. The ’60’s were starting to become my favorite period of music, and almost as suddenly as my show was cut down to a single hour, it completely switched to all-Nuggets, all the time.
I became extremely systematic about my music consumption during this period, and started tracking down all the bands on these comps at the library, and in the KPSU catalog. (At the time, KPSU had a huge CD catalog of ’60’s music.) I saw this particular strain of the ’60’s to be the precursor of punk, and while this is not a new observation (the original Nuggets record used the word “punk” to describe this era), to me it felt like a revelation. I did all I could to become knowledgeable, and in many ways – to this very day – I find this era endlessly vital. There are always new discoveries to be made, and new sounds to immerse myself in.
One common practice that I regularly indulged in while at KPSU was new DJ training, and during this show I went through the process with my friend, Katie. I was a little sad to find that she never got past the apprenticing phase, as I would have loved to hear a show that she regularly hosted. However, we got to do this show together, and now that she no longer lives in the area, this is really the only reminder of her that I have.
This is a pre-podcast era show, as was transferred from a Mini-Disc recording I made of the program. The mix on this show is pretty great, and contains some of my favorite musical gems. I also find it interesting that this show comes from a time when I did four, 15 minute blocks, instead of three, 20 minute blocks. Oh, how things have changed.
